What Is Property Management Software?
It’s a digital tool that automates core tasks such as rent collection, maintenance requests, tenant screening, document storage, and financial reporting — all in one platform.
Key Benefits for Small Landlords
- Automated billing & rent reminders
- Digital document storage (leases, receipts, notices)
- Instant financial reports for cash-flow visibility
- Centralized tenant communication via email or app
Must-Have Features in 2025
- Mobile apps for quick updates on the go
- Online payment integration with automatic reconciliation
- Real-time maintenance notifications
- Tax reporting tools that simplify end-of-year filing
Popular Platforms to Consider
Here are a few well-known solutions that cater to small landlords (often with free or low-cost tiers):
- TenantCloud – intuitive interface, free plan for up to a few units.
- Buildium (Starter Plan) – robust reporting, online payments.
- RentRedi – mobile-first, flat monthly pricing.
Tips for Choosing the Right Software
- Match the plan to the number of units you manage.
- Look for ease of use and a clean dashboard.
- Check customer support quality and user reviews.
- Take advantage of free trials before committing.
